    I started as a dancer in this community, and am so proud to now lead it alongside my soul sister, Vanessa. I’ve always been an advocate for unabashed sexual expression, diverse media representation, and the belief that anyone can be a dancer. I studied Communications, Media, Gender, and Sexuality because I’m passionate about how sex, the stage, and society intersect. My career started in non-profit arts before catapulting into the hyper-capitalist male-dominated tech industry; and I’ve since swung the pendulum back by “Robin Hooding” (reworking) Fortune 500 formulas designed to make the rich richer, to instead build local, heart-centered, decolonized communities. Luminesque once showed me that I deserved to be seen and celebrated when I needed it most, and so now I’ve made it my job to use my privilege, resources, and experience to carve out spaces for underrepresented humans to witness themselves and be witnessed through the universal art of dance/sex/movement. I couldn’t do any of this without my brilliant team and supportive family, so thank you for standing by Vanessa and I while we slowly change the world one stiletto’d step at a time.
